Home
last modified time | relevance | path

Searched refs:ixheaacd_sat16 (Results 1 – 4 of 4) sorted by relevance

/external/libxaac/decoder/
Dixheaacd_lt_predict.c438 (WORD16)-ixheaacd_sat16(overlap[255 - i]), 1), in ixheaacd_lt_update_state()
443 (WORD16)ixheaacd_shl16((WORD16)-ixheaacd_sat16(overlap[i]), 1), in ixheaacd_lt_update_state()
453 (WORD16)-ixheaacd_sat16(overlap[239 - i]), 1), in ixheaacd_lt_update_state()
458 (WORD16)ixheaacd_shl16((WORD16)-ixheaacd_sat16(overlap[i]), 1), in ixheaacd_lt_update_state()
465 (WORD16)-ixheaacd_sat16(overlap[511 - i]), in ixheaacd_lt_update_state()
471 ixheaacd_mult16x16in32_shl((WORD16)-ixheaacd_sat16(overlap[i]), in ixheaacd_lt_update_state()
480 ixheaacd_shl16((WORD16)-ixheaacd_sat16(overlap[511 - i]), 1); in ixheaacd_lt_update_state()
486 (WORD16)-ixheaacd_sat16(overlap[511 - 448 - i]), in ixheaacd_lt_update_state()
493 ixheaacd_mult16x16in32_shl((WORD16)-ixheaacd_sat16(overlap[i]), in ixheaacd_lt_update_state()
503 ixheaacd_shl16(ixheaacd_sat16(overlap[i]), 1); in ixheaacd_lt_update_state()
[all …]
Dixheaacd_basic_ops16.h23 static PLATFORM_INLINE WORD16 ixheaacd_sat16(WORD32 op1) { in ixheaacd_sat16() function
48 var_out = ixheaacd_sat16(sum); in ixheaacd_add16_sat()
64 var_out = ixheaacd_sat16(diff); in ixheaacd_sub16_sat()
87 var_out = ixheaacd_sat16(temp); in ixheaacd_mult16_shl_sat()
106 var_out = ixheaacd_sat16(temp); in ixheaacd_shl16_sat()
321 var_out = ixheaacd_sat16(temp); in mac16_shl_sat()
Dixheaacd_basic_funcs.c34 #define sat16_m(a) ixheaacd_sat16(a)
187 result = ixheaacd_shr32_dir_sat_limit(op, ixheaacd_sat16(shift - 1)); in ixheaacd_sqrt()
Dixheaacd_ps_dec.c77 var_out = ixheaacd_sat16(temp); in ixheaacd_shl16_saturate()